Bitcoin, the leading cryptocurrency, has gained significant attention for its potential to revolutionize the financial landscape. As digital currencies continue to evolve, many investors are eager to understand how to predict the future worth of Bitcoin. Accurate predictions can help guide investment decisions, but forecasting Bitcoin’s value is challenging due to various influencing factors. In this article, we will explore key methods and indicators used to predict the future price of Bitcoin, providing an in-depth look at the elements involved in the process.
Market Trends and Historical Data
One of the most important tools for predicting Bitcoin’s future value is analyzing market trends and historical price data. By studying past price fluctuations, market sentiment, and trading volume, analysts can identify recurring patterns that may suggest future movements. Technical analysis, which involves using statistical data to forecast price trends, is commonly employed by traders to make informed predictions.
Supply and Demand Factors
Bitcoin’s price is highly influenced by supply and demand dynamics. The total supply of Bitcoin is capped at 21 million, creating scarcity, which can drive up the price when demand increases. Events such as Bitcoin halvings, which reduce the reward for mining, also play a significant role in influencing supply and demand. Monitoring these factors helps investors gauge potential price movements.
Macroeconomic and Regulatory Environment
The broader economic environment and government regulations have a major impact on Bitcoin’s price. Factors such as inflation, interest rates, and government regulations regarding cryptocurrency can influence investor behavior. Positive regulatory news or widespread adoption can lead to price increases, while negative news can result in declines.
In conclusion, predicting the future value of Bitcoin involves a combination of technical analysis, supply-demand considerations, and macroeconomic factors. While no method can guarantee accuracy, understanding these elements can provide a more informed approach to forecasting Bitcoin’s price trends.
